Code of Rights Series_Activities of Daily Living Explain what constitutes bullying and(includes Te Reo Maori captions) Course Description: All people who use a health or disability service are protected by the Code of Rights. This course explains the 10 rights of Code and outlines the obligations and duties that organisations are required to adhere to.
